      Launching a business during an economic downturn might seem counterintuitive, but it can be a shrewd move for those who approach it with careful planning and strategy. While recessions pose challenges, they also present unique opportunities for entrepreneurs to establish themselves in a market ripe for innovation and value-driven solutions.

      Navigating the Economic Undertow

      Recessions often lead to a shift in consumer behavior, with individuals and businesses seeking ways to save money, streamline operations, and prioritize essential goods and services. This shift creates openings for businesses that can cater to these evolving needs.

      1. Identify Market Gaps and Emerging Needs: Entrepreneurs should keenly observe the changing market landscape and identify gaps that their business can fill. This might involve offering affordable alternatives to existing products, providing cost-effective solutions to common problems, or catering to underserved customer segments.

      2. Prioritize Efficiency and Cost-Effectiveness: During a recession, businesses need to operate with lean and efficient structures. This involves minimizing overhead costs, negotiating favorable deals with suppliers, and utilizing technology to streamline operations.

      3. Embrace Innovation and Adaptability: Recessions can drive innovation as businesses seek new ways to attract customers and gain a competitive edge. This might involve developing new products or services, expanding into new markets, or adopting innovative marketing strategies.

      4. Embrace Resourcefulness and Creativity: Resourcefulness becomes crucial during challenging times. Entrepreneurs can explore creative ways to utilize existing resources, partner with other businesses, and leverage community support to minimize expenses and maximize their impact.

      Building a Sustainable Foundation

      While recessions present economic challenges, they also offer opportunities for businesses to build a solid foundation for long-term success.

      1. Conduct Thorough Market Research: Before launching a business, it’s essential to conduct thorough market research to understand the competitive landscape, identify target customers, and assess the viability of the business idea.

      2. Develop a Comprehensive Business Plan: A well-crafted business plan serves as a roadmap for the company’s growth, outlining its mission, target market, financial projections, and marketing strategies.

      3. Establish Financial Discipline: Financial discipline is paramount during a recession. Entrepreneurs should carefully manage their finances, create realistic budgets, and explore funding options that align with their business goals.

      4. Foster a Strong Customer Focus: Building a loyal customer base is essential for business survival. Entrepreneurs should focus on providing exceptional customer service, addressing customer needs promptly, and adapting to changing customer preferences.

      5. Leverage Technology and Online Platforms: Technology can play a pivotal role in reaching a wider audience and reducing costs. Entrepreneurs should explore digital marketing strategies, utilize online platforms for sales and customer engagement, and consider remote work arrangements.

      Remember, recessions are not permanent, and businesses that navigate them successfully can emerge stronger and more resilient, poised to capitalize on the economic recovery. By embracing innovation, prioritizing efficiency, and maintaining a customer-centric approach, entrepreneurs can establish themselves as enduring pioneers in the marketplace.
